As its first initiative, DI Foundation presents Food Court Remastered. Retailers around the world are facing their greatest-ever challenge as the COVID-19 pandemic grips every country. How are owners and retailers in your country but also other regions of the world coping and responding to the needs of their customers, communities, and the business itself? One thing we are all certain of is that guests’ safety has become of much greater importance.

Gianluca Gerosa, President in pectore of DI Foundation, said: “The key in this particular moment – where Hospitality, Shopping, Food and Entertainment venues are gradually re-opening their doors to the public – is guaranteeing safety without compromising customer experience and community engagement. As a nonprofit organisation, focused on socially sustainable projects, we have thought of a service product that couldhelp the Retail & Leisure world in this challenging period which we have branded as Food Court Remastered”.

Design International Foundation has sponsored Food Court Remastered, an easy to use Design Planning Service, delivered by Design International, that enables Malls Owners to re-configure the food courts within their properties, wherever they are in the world. Aligned with the company’s corporate social responsibilities and ethical values, Design International will reorganise the layout of 300 Food Courts in 300 design days, matching the 300 malls that the company has completed over its 55 years of history.

Food Court Remastered is available to all mall owners from 12 May 2020 at www.designinternational.com/giveback, with an App to follow swiftly that will enhance customer experience.
